F1: Vettel confirms Red Bull blocked early release
Sebastian Vettel has confirmed that Red Bull has blocked him from joining Ferrari early enough to test in Abu Dhabi next month. The final race of the season is followed by a two-day test which could have seen Vettel make his Ferrari debut. However, Vettel confirmed ahead of the United States Grand Prix weekend that he would not be able to drive for another team in Abu Dhabi, with Red Bull having blocked his early release. “Well first of all I'm looking forward to the race here,” Vettel said. “The race weekend here and to enjoy those last races I will have with the team. Obviously we've experienced a lot in the last couple of years so I think it will be a very special moment coming up...
